ADNOC Gas, a key subsidiary of Abu Dhabi National Oil Company, has announced its results for the second quarter of 2026, delivering net income of $665 million despite exceptional external disruption during the period.
This was above the upper end of the $400-600 million guidance range provided in the first quarter, reflecting strong operational performance in a challenging operating environment, said the Emirati gas giant, adding it was supported by resilient margins in the domestic gas business.
The Company achieved a significant milestone in executing its long-term growth strategy by taking Final Investment Decisions (FIDs) and awarding engineering, procurement and construction (EPC) contracts for Phases 2 and 3 of its Rich Gas Development (RGD) Project.

These investment decisions raise ADNOC Gas' targeted EBITDA growth to 60 percent by 2030 versus 2023 - an upgrade from the previously communicated target of more than 40 percent over 2023-2029. The upgrade reflects the long-term value creation of the Company's project portfolio and its disciplined approach to capital allocation. ADNOC Gas now expects to invest approximately $28 billion between 2026 and 2030 to deliver this growth ambition.
ADNOC Gas has awarded $8.2 billion in EPC contracts for Phases 2 and 3 of the RGD project - $3.9 billion for Phase 2, to Wison Engineering, and $4.3 billion for Phase 3, to Tecnimont. These contracts build on Phase 1, announced in June 2025, which is expanding key processing units to increase throughput and improve operational efficiency, across multiple gas assets.
Phase 2, to be delivered by Wison Engineering, will add a new natural gas processing train at the Habshan facility, expanding ADNOC Gas' natural gas processing capacity, enhancing operational flexibility, and supporting the UAE's expanding downstream and petrochemical sectors. Phase 3, to be delivered by Tecnimont, will add a new natural gas liquids (NGL) fractionation train at Ruwais, increasing the recovery of higher-value liquids from rich natural gas for export, strengthening its global customer portfolio.
Together with the $5 billion committed to Phase 1, the new awards bring total investment in the RGD project to $13.2 billion. It will benefit from higher associated gas volumes as ADNOC progresses towards its production capacity ambitions.
ADNOC Gas said it was executing one of the largest gas growth programmes in the industry, spanning four megaprojects - Ruwais LNG, Maximising Ethane Recovery and Monetisation (MERAM), RGD and Estidama - which together are expected to generate $13.4 billion in In-Country Value (ICV), thus reinforcing the Company's contribution to the UAE's industrial development and economic diversification goals.
The programme continues to progress, with MERAM expected delivery in 2027 and Ruwais LNG and Estidama both advancing as planned.
This growth is further underpinned by ADNOC's continued investment across the gas value chain - including the recently announced Bab Gas Cap and Umm Shaif Gas Cap developments - which will bring more natural gas and associated gas liquids into ADNOC Gas' integrated value chain, supporting additional feedstock, processing volumes, LNG exports and higher revenue streams, it added.
ADNOC Gas is also scaling artificial intelligence and robotics - from aerial drones and four-legged inspection robots to tank-climbing crawlers - across its assets, with the potential to cut inspection costs by up to 75 percent, complete certain inspections up to 15 times faster and remove personnel from hazardous environments as it advances toward increasingly autonomous operations.
Impressed by the results, the Board has approved a quarterly dividend of $940 million, payable in September 2026, in line with the commitment to deliver annual dividend growth of 5% through 2030. ADNOC Gas remains the largest dividend payer on the ADX.
